Prosecutor seeks life sentence for Ruben Vardanyan

The court proceedings in the criminal case against Armenian citizen Ruben Vardanyan, accused under the Criminal Code of the Republic of Azerbaijan of crimes against peace and humanity, war crimes, as well as terrorism, financing of terrorism, and other grave offenses, continued on December 18.

Axar.az informs the prosecutor defending the state prosecution addressed the court hearing held at the Baku Military Court.

In his remarks, the prosecutor called for a life sentence to be handed out to Ruben Vardanyan.
